Zagat just released their annual list of Philadelphia’s best restaurants, but where are the Latino flavors?

Around 5000 diners voted on more than 650 area restaurants in the Philadelphia Restaurant Survey. Only four of the 50 selected were Latino restaurants.

Two of Jose Garces’ Spanish restaurants, Amada and Tinto, landed the number 7 and number 23 spots on the list. Brazilian steakhouses also seem to be popular among Philadelphia diners with Fogo De Chão ranking at number 12 and Chima Brazilian Steakhouse at number 36.

There is no doubt that those restaurants have amazing food, but what about all of the delicious places that were left off of the list like Los Taquitos de Puebla in the Italian Market, Alma de Cuba in Center City, Loco Pez in Fishtown and Tierra Colombiana in North Philly?

Zagat has a separate list for the best Mexican restaurants in Philly, but it lacks the diversity of other Latino cultures and cuisine.

Philadelphia's food scene has so much to explore, but don't miss out on experiencing Latino cuisine that didn't make the list.
